Strony

Archive for the ‘Android’ Category

Transportoid jedzie dalej

piątek, Wrzesień 12th, 2014

Drodzy użytkownicy!

Cztery i pół roku pracy nad Transportoidem były niesamowitą przygodą. Nigdy nie spodziewałbym się, że dzięki pisanemu po godzinach programowi na komórki wystąpię w Parlamencie Europejskim, trafię jako aktywista do telewizji czy wygram publiczny plebiscyt na najlepszego programistę.

Zdecydowanie ważniejsze było jednak to, że wraz z Piotrem Owcarzem (autorem skryptów generujących rozkłady), Tomkiem Przybylskim (autorem wydania dla Windows Phone) i wszystkimi użytkownikami wersji premium mogliśmy ufundować ćwierć studni w Sudanie, zasilając konto Polskiej Akcji Humanitarnej kwotą kilkunastu tysięcy złotych. To konkretne dobro, które udało się zrealizować dzięki Wam. Serdecznie dziękuję za to i za wszystkie wyrazy sympatii i uznania przesyłane zespołowi w ciągu minionych lat.

Za kilka dni prowadzenie projektu przejmą nowi właściciele; MOBIEM jest agencją mobile marketingu z solidnym zapleczem developerskim. To dla Transportoida nowe otwarcie, powrót do aktywnego developmentu i szansa na realizację wielu innowacyjnych pomysłów, które zwiększą użyteczność aplikacji. Zmianom tym będę kibicował już jako zwykły użytkownik.

Tomek Zieliński

Widżety na ekranie blokady

poniedziałek, Styczeń 13th, 2014

Do Google Play trafił Transportoid w wersji 6.1, nowością jest możliwość wstawiania widżetów na ekran blokady. Widżety takie zachowują numerację wspólną z widżetami na pulpicie, w aplikacji są obsługiwane w dotychczasowy sposób. Funkcja dostępna jest dla użytkowników Androida od wersji 4.2, stanowią oni obecnie 13% ogółu.

W wersji tej zmienia się sposób raportowania błędów po zawieszeniu aplikacji. Zamiast generowania maila z opisem usterki, aplikacja wyśle ten sam zestaw informacji do dedykowanego serwisu. Pozwoli to na łatwiejszą identyfikację najczęściej występujących problemów oraz analizę statystyczną zebranych danych (np. stwierdzenie, że błąd X występuje tylko na urządzeniach marki Y lub wersji systemu Z).

Transportoid za darmo na Åšwięta, 30% taniej do końca roku

niedziela, Grudzień 22nd, 2013

Pokłon pasterzy, Gerard van Honthorst 1622

Oto tegoroczny prezent gwiazdkowy dla wszystkich użytkowników Transportoida – przez święta Bożego Narodzenia możesz korzystać z pełnej wersji programu za darmo a do końca roku kupić abonament tańszy o 30%

Aby pobrać darmowy abonament ważny do 31 grudnia 2013, wypełnij ten formularz i postępuj zgodnie z otrzymanymi instrukcjami. Zniżka na abonament roczny obowiązuje przy płatności przez Google Play (Android) oraz Allegro (oba systemy), do końca roku zapłacisz jedynie 7 zł.

Jednocześnie przypominamy, że w Boże Narodzenie oraz Nowy Rok wielu przewoźników jeździ według specjalnych, świątecznych rozkładów jazdy. Transportoid pokaże w te dni rozkłady niedzielne i wyświetli stosowne ostrzeżenie, podróżujących prosimy o sprawdzenie rozkładów na stronach WWW przewoźników. Prosimy też o weryfikację odjazdów w Wigilię i między świętami a Sylwestrem – niekiedy również w te dni rozkłady są zmienione zaś informacja o tym pojawia się jedynie na przystankach.

Transportoid z nowym tematem graficznym wydany

środa, Październik 23rd, 2013

Do dystrybucji w Google Play trafił Transportoid 6.0 – przynoszący radykalną zmianę kolorystyki programu. Wystrój z czarnym tłem, bazujący na wyglądzie Androida 1.0, został zastąpiony nowocześniejszym, jasnym tematem graficznym opartym na temacie Holo z Androida 4.0. Jak wspominałem w poprzedniej notce, obecny wygląd aplikacji został zaprojektowany przez Taylora Linga, specjalistę od androidowego UX/UI.

Wszyscy użytkownicy, którzy wytykali przestarzały wygląd programu, mają powody do zadowolenia, pojawiły się za to głosy sprzeciwu ze strony tych, którzy woleli, jak było kiedyś. Wyjaśnienie, czemu w programie nie pojawiła się opcja przełączania kolorystyki, wymaga zagłębienia się w szczegóły techniczne.

W czasach Androida 2.x producenci sprzętu zwykli byli modyfikować domyślny temat graficzny, np. zamieniając domyślny zielony akcent w pomarańczowy lub niebieski; czasem podmieniali także wygląd albo rozmiary niektórych kontrolek. Jeśli ktoś chciał mieć kontrolę nad każdym aspektem wyglądu programu, musiał tak naprawdę od zera przedefiniować wszystkie elementy wystroju. Wraz z Androidem 4.0 pojawił się wygląd Holo, czyli zestaw niezmiennych kontrolek i kolorów oraz wytyczne dotyczące ich użycia. Nieco wcześniej, w zapomnianej już edycji 3.0, wprowadzono ActionBar czyli powiększoną belkę tytułową aplikacji zawierającą obok tytułu także ikony często wybieranych akcji. Twórcy aplikacji stanęli przed problemem – jak zapanować nad ich wyglądem w różnych wersjach systemu operacyjnego.

Kilku biegłych programistów postanowiło zniwelować różnice przygotowując biblioteki przenoszące do Androida 2.x kontrolkę ActionBar (biblioteka ActionBarSherlock) oraz nowoczesny wygląd Holo (biblioteka HoloEverywhere). Obie mają neutralne działanie w nowszych wersjach systemu, lecz w starszych wnikają głęboko w kolorystykę i sposób wyświetlania oraz działania elementów na ekranie. Zmiany wykraczają poza proste kolorowanie przycisków, np. wygląd jednego wiersza listy zależy od koloru okna, koloru tła kontrolki, warstw nakładkowych (overlay) reagujących na dotyk i animowanie, tła wiersza, definicji wyglądu indywidualnej kontrolki (wariant podstawowy, wyłączony, aktywny, podświetlony). Nie jest to rzecz tak prosta, jak zdefiniowanie koloru X dla przycisku Y czy ustalenie wystroju stylami CSS.

Implementacja wybór jasnego lub ciemnego motywu graficznego byłaby względnie łatwa w Androidzie 4, trudna przy użyciu jednej ze wspomnianych bibliotek i niemal niemożliwa przy ich jednoczesnym wykorzystaniu. Prace nad tą funkcją opóźniłyby premierę o wiele tygodni, bez gwarancji sukcesu. Ceną za przeniesienie nowego wyglądu na starą platformę jest więc przywiązanie do jednego – w tym przypadku jasnego – tematu graficznego. Być może ulegnie to zmianie w przyszłości, gdy Android 2.x wyjdzie z użycia (obecnie korzysta z niego 46% użytkowników programu).

Problemów nie ma za to ze zmianą motywu widżetów wstawianych na ekran domowy – w opcjach programu można wybrać ich kolor i przezroczystość.

Transportoid z nowym wyglądem w testach

poniedziałek, Wrzesień 16th, 2013

Gdy w lutym 2010 do dystrybucji trafiła pierwsza publiczna wersja Transportoida, najnowszy Android nosił oznaczenie 2.1. Od tamtego czasu w świecie androidowego designu zmieniło się praktycznie wszystko – kolory, kontrolki ekranowe, ikony, krój tekstu, wzorce i wzory. Niniejszym do testów oddajemy nową wersję programu, z wyglądem dostosowanym do współczesnych trendów i wytycznych.

(kliknij aby powiększyć)

Z prośbą o zaprojektowanie zmodernizowanego wyglądu zwróciliśmy się do Taylora Linga, zawodowego projektanta i eksperta UX/UI. W świecie developerów Androida Taylor znany jest m.in. z szablonów do projektowania GUI oraz licznych propozycji konwersji istniejących aplikacji do wersji HOLO. Otrzymany projekt zakłada utrzymanie podziału głównego ekranu na cztery zakładki, do którego przez lata przywykły tysiące użytkowników (oczywiście nowa implementacja pozwala na zmianę zakładek gestem swype). Cały wystrój zmieniamy z ciemnego na jasny, bardziej czytelny w warunkach polowych.

Wersja beta jest już do pobrania z Google Play, jako aktualizację zobaczą ją członkowie społeczności Transportoida w Google+ (aktualizacja może nie być dostępna od razu po dołączeniu, restart telefonu może pomóc ale nie musi). Wszystkich betatesterów bardzo proszę o ocenę nowego wyglądu i zgłaszanie dostrzeżonych usterek. Preferowany jest kontakt e-mailowy, z odpowiedzią mogę zwlekać kilka dni. Zmiany mają przede wszystkich charakter wizualny, proszę więc o załączanie zrzutów ekranu z naniesionymi uwagami.

W poniższym archiwum znajduje się kolekcja zrzutów ekranów ilustrujących poniższy wpis. Sekcja Screenshoty zostanie zaktualizowana po wydaniu produkcyjnej wersji programu.

(kliknij aby powiększyć)

(kliknij aby powiększyć)

(kliknij aby powiększyć)

(kliknij aby powiększyć)

 

mPay w sieci T-Mobile

niedziela, Czerwiec 16th, 2013

Dzisiejsze wydanie Transportoida dla systemu Android odblokowuje możliwość kupowania biletów w systemie mPay użytkownikom sieci T-Mobile. Wygodne menu zwalnia z konieczności zapisywania kodów USSD, w obsługiwanych przez mPay miastach bilety dostępne są pod przyciskiem wyświetlanym w zakładce „Ulubione”.

Osobom, które często korzystają z tej możliwości, może przypaść do gustu dodatek Dzwonek, który sam zatwierdza wybór kodu i rozpoczyna transakcję. Kod PIN finalizujący zakup musi być za każdym razem wpisany ręcznie.

Przedstawiamy nowe logo Transportoida

niedziela, Czerwiec 2nd, 2013

Stare logo projektu było z nami od zawsze, nie da się jednak ukryć, że znajduje się ono w czołówce wyników wyszukiwania hasła „free bus icon”. Dziś prezentujemy nowe logo, całkiem własne i unikalne. Nawiązuje do poprzedniego kolorystyką i układem ale tym razem autobus jest miejski, nie turystyczny.

Na potrzeby mediów publikujemy archiwum obrazów w wysokiej rozdzielczości – do wykorzystania w publikacjach dotyczących Transportoida.

Komentarze w Google Play

niedziela, Czerwiec 2nd, 2013

Od kilkunastu dni autorzy aplikacji mogą odpowiadać na opinie publikowane przez użytkowników w Google Play. To cenna możliwość, zaczęliśmy z niej korzystać. Bardzo prosimy, by nie używać systemu komentarzy do zgłaszania usterek; po pierwsze nie mamy możliwości kontaktu z osobą komentującą (a notki z informacją o błędzie w rozkładach z reguły nie wskazują miasta), po drugie błędy i braki często poprawiamy z dnia na dzień zaś negatywny komentarz zostaje na zawsze.

Oczywiście mile widziane są oceny i opinie dotyczące aplikacji jako takiej – my zaś jesteśmy dumni z tego, że ponad 80% wszystkich ocen Transportoida w Google Play to noty pięciogwiazdkowe. Podobnie jest w Windows Marketplace – tam również zagregowana ocena aplikacji to cztery i pół gwiazdki. Dzięki!

Społeczność Transportoida w Google+

czwartek, Maj 30th, 2013

Google Play umożliwia od niedawna dystrybucję testowych wersji aplikacji dla Androida, warunkiem udziału w betatestach jest korzystanie z Google+.

Chciałbym wypróbować ten mechanizm. Proszę wszystkich zainteresowanych o dołączenie do społeczności Transportoida w Google+ a następnie użycie poniższego odnośnika, by potwierdzić udział w testach: https://play.google.com/apps/testing/com.transportoid (jeśli pod drugim linkiem widzisz stronę logowania do konsoli developerskiej, wróć do pierwszego kroku i najpierw dołącz do społeczności).

Jeśli wszystko pójdzie dobrze (zapewne trzeba będzie odczekać krótszą bądź dłuższą chwilę), uczestnik betatestów powinien zobaczyć i pobrać w mobilnej aplikacji Google Play Transportoida w wersji 5.2.3, poprawiającej błąd definiowania zawartości widżetów w Samsungu Galaxy S2. Proszę o sygnał, czy tak się stało – najchętniej w komentarzach na stronie społeczności w G+, ale może być też mail i Facebook. O ile się orientuję, webowa wersja Google Play nie pokaże takiej aktualizacji.

PS: jeśli chodzi o Transportoida dla Windows Phone, tydzień temu został wysłany do Marketplace i utknął jeden krok przed certyfikacją. Zgrzytamy zębami i czekamy.

Nowy format bazy dla Krakowa, szczegóły trasy

sobota, Luty 9th, 2013

Od dziś bazy danych z rozkładami dla Krakowa są dostępne w nowym formacie – możliwe staje się więc wyszukiwanie połączeń z dwiema przesiadkami i określanie godziny dojazdu na miejsce. Aby pobrać nową bazę, należy wybrać opcję Menu → Więcej → Sprawdź aktualizacje.

MPK Kraków od miesiąca ignoruje próby uzyskania jakichkolwiek informacji (w tym złożony na początku roku wniosek o dostęp do współrzędnych słupków przystankowych i ich identyfikatorów), nie jesteśmy więc w stanie wyświetlić na mapie, przy których słupkach zatrzymują się poszczególne kursy. Brak współpracy to zresztą nic nowego, od wrześniowego wyroku żaden z kilkudziesięciu kolejnych wniosków o ponowne wykorzystanie informacji publicznej nie doprowadził do otrzymania aktualnych danych rozkładowych. Do tematu niebawem powrócę.

Transportoid w wersji dla Androida potrafi od niedawna wyświetlać szczegóły wyszukanych połączeń – wystarczy dotknięcie wybranej pozycji (przytrzymanie palca przywołuje menu kontekstowe). Nowa funkcja dostępna jest dla rozkładów w nowym formacie, czyli Krakowa, Warszawy, Wrocławia i Białegostoku. Niebawem KZK GOP, Trójmiasto i kolejne miasta.

 


  • Kanał RSS
  • Blip
  • Twitter
  • Facebook
Social Slider